RWII Prevention and Response Tools for Public Health Professionals
Below, public health professionals can find various materials to help them inform the public, media, community leaders, and others about Recreational Water Illness and Injury (RWII) Prevention Week. These resources are meant to assist public health professionals engage their target audiences and increase awareness of this yearly observance.
